About the Rann Of Kutch

The Rann of Kutch is a vast salt desert located in the Kutch district of Gujarat, India. Known for its stunning white landscape, unique wildlife, and vibrant culture, it attracts tourists from around the world. The Rann is famous for the Rann Utsav, a cultural festival that showcases local crafts, music, and dance.

How to Reach Rann Of Kutch

✈️

Air

The nearest airport is Bhuj Airport, approximately 80 km away.;

🚌

Bus

Regular bus services operate from major cities to Bhuj.

🚆

Train

Bhuj is well-connected by train to major cities in Gujarat.
